Hon. Samuel Okudzeto Ablakwa Writes 

With honour and deep respect, I responded positively to a special invitation from the government of the United Arab Emirates to pay a two day official visit to their incredibly beautiful and inspiring country.

I was warmly received by His Highness Sheikh Abdullah bin Zayed Al Nahyan, Deputy Prime Minister of UAE who also serves as Minister for Foreign Affairs.

I further held constructive meetings with my good brother, Sheikh Shakhboot bin Nahyan Al Nahyan, Minister of State, my dear sister Lana Nusseibeh, Assistant Minister for Political Affairs, the ministers of Foreign Trade, Investment, and captains of industry.

A significant outcome was the signing of an agreement to commence the first ever high-level political consultations in the strategic interest of both countries.

We obtained commitments from UAE companies who will be arriving in Ghana over the next few weeks to invest in sectors such as renewable energy, AI, education, health, aviation and defense — consistent with President Mahama’s declaration that Ghana is open for business again.

We also discussed two priority areas of President Mahama’s government being labour export for Ghanaian youth to UAE and technical support for a new national airline.

Massive job openings in UAE will soon be announced for the Ghanaian youth when we finalize our CEPA negotiations shortly.

Both sides confirmed that the bilateral engagements on Sunday and Monday have not only been exceptionally successful but historic.
